Ticket #—: Vault locked us out again (Sprocketwatch scanner)

Hey newcomers — the Sprocketwatch typo-squatting package scanner failed its nightly run because the Hollyfen vault auto-locked after three bad token attempts. Happens more than we'd like. To unlock: open the vault console, pick "manual recovery," and re-enable the scanner's service account. The console will prompt for the recovery passphrase, which is appended below.

recovery phrase for fawif-tajeg: norael-aldmir-casir-brivan-ulaion

# Break-Glass: Cron → Flowster Migration

All legacy cron jobs at Pindle Systems now run in Flowster. If Flowster's scheduler is down, break-glass access re-enables the dormant cron host. Use sparingly; disable again after recovery. Unlocking the cron host's sealed config requires the emergency passphrase recorded immediately below.

vault phrase of tajeg-tageg = pelix-druix-holius-briael-zorwyn-frawyn-fraox-norok-drueth-aldiel

## Deployment

Fernhop sits behind the Oakgate load balancer, which pings the health endpoint every few seconds. Fail three checks and you're out of rotation, so don't make the health handler do anything slow — no DB calls, promise. Readiness and liveness are separate paths on purpose; keep it that way. The balancer expects the following settings.

config for kagup-hahig:
druwyn:
  pin: 2801
  metrics_host: metrics.druwyn.zemvarlabs.internal
  tenant: sorius
  seal: seal_798a43d7